Perf tune get_frame_size_info
It turns out that for scalar sizes 0..24, frames are always the same size. That range includes all current use-cases - and then some - so get rid of the hash table. Old code preserved under #ifdef VLIB_SUPPORTS_ARBITRARY_SCALAR_SIZES. Change-Id: Ic005c7143c9639f77d1a0fadd2fc0e90dccb68c1 Signed-off-by: Dave Barach <dbarach@cisco.com>
